About Hálfdán Ágústsson

Hálfdán Ágústsson is a scholar working on Atmospheric Science, Global and Planetary Change, Environmental Engineering, Oceanography and Earth-Surface Processes, having authored 24 papers that have together received 405 indexed citations. Recurring topics across this work include Meteorological Phenomena and Simulations (17 papers), Climate variability and models (12 papers), Cryospheric studies and observations (8 papers), Wind and Air Flow Studies (6 papers), Aeolian processes and effects (4 papers), Tropical and Extratropical Cyclones Research (3 papers), Landslides and related hazards (2 papers) and Winter Sports Injuries and Performance (2 papers). The work is most often cited by research in Atmospheric Science (326 citations), Environmental Engineering (140 citations), Global and Planetary Change (175 citations), Earth-Surface Processes (31 citations) and Aerospace Engineering (78 citations). Hálfdán Ágústsson has collaborated with scholars based in Iceland, Norway and United States. Frequent co-authors include Haraldur Ólafsson, Finnur Pálsson, Eyjólfur Magnússon, P. Crochet, Joaquín M. C. Belart, Joachim Reuder, Marius O. Jonassen, Jian‐Wen Bao, Etienne Cheynet and Trond Kvamsdal. Their work appears in journals such as Meteorologische Zeitschrift, Monthly Weather Review, Journal of Wind Engineering and Industrial Aerodynamics, Atmosphere and Tellus A Dynamic Meteorology and Oceanography.
